Abstract

The utility model belongs to the technical field of cutting beds, and particularly relates to a driving belt mechanism with a dynamic tensioning device. The driving belt mechanism with the dynamic tensioning device comprises a driving wheel and a first driven wheel which are arranged up and down in a spaced mode. A second driven wheel is arranged on one side of the driving wheel and the first driven wheel, and the driving wheel, the first driven wheel and the second driven wheel are connected through a driving belt. The second driven wheel can move up and down, tensioning wheels which can be used for tensioning the driving belt are arranged on one side of the second driven wheel, and the tensioning wheels can move up and down along the second driven wheel to form a dynamic tensioning device. According to the driving belt mechanism with the dynamic tensioning device, through combination of an eccentric tensioning device and the dynamic tensioning device, an automatic cutting bed can keep certain output power and normal movement of the mechanism in the process that an entire cutter device ascends and descends; the eccentric tensioning device is suitable for common tensioning mechanism places which are small in requirement for space and not suitable for screws, the eccentric tensioning device is suitable for meeting the demand that the driving belt needs to be moved up and down frequently in the operation process of the driving belt, driving is stable, and outputting is stable.

Description

A kind of belt mechanism with dynamic tension device
Technical field:
The utility model belongs to cutting technical field, refers in particular to a kind of belt mechanism with dynamic tension device.
Background technique:
In prior art, expansion tightening wheel is static fixing, (as: common expansion tightening wheel can be fixed on frame to be somewhere fixed on the position that workpiece do not move, do not move up and down with workpiece and move, for state of rest), such tensioning mode easily makes band fluff in the part moving up and down, and jumps tooth if there is the synchronous pulley of tooth to encounter in ascending and descending process.
Summary of the invention:
The purpose of this utility model is to provide the belt mechanism with dynamic tension device that remains tensioning state in a kind of compact structure, ascending and descending process.
The utility model is achieved in that
A kind of belt mechanism with dynamic tension device, include upper and lower spaced driving wheel and the first follower, one side of driving wheel and follower is provided with the second follower, driving wheel, the first follower and the second follower connect by driving belt, the second described follower can move up and down, be provided with the Idle wheel of tensioning driving belt in a side of the second follower, Idle wheel can move up and down and form dynamic tension device with the second follower.
Above-mentioned driving wheel and the first follower are arranged in frame, and the second follower is arranged on fitting seat, and fitting seat is arranged on a side of frame, and can move up and down.
In above-mentioned frame, be provided with the eccentric center tensioner device that regulates centre distance between driving wheel and the first follower.
Above-mentioned eccentric center tensioner device includes eccentric rotating disk and fixed base, eccentric rotating disk is arranged on the top of fixed base, the first follower is arranged on fixed base, on fixed base, be provided with bar hole, fixed base is connected with frame on bar hole by screw fastening, the position of adjusting screw in bar hole and then the upper-lower position of adjusting the first follower, on eccentric rotating disk, eccentric setting has running shaft core, running shaft core is connected with frame, on eccentric rotating disk, be also provided with fixing bolt, in frame, relevant position is provided with arcuate socket, eccentric rotating disk is around running shaft core eccentric rotary and act on fixed base and regulate the upper-lower position of fixed base, fixing bolt is fastened on arcuate socket rotating disk is fixed in frame.
Above-mentioned Idle wheel includes upper and lower spaced the first Idle wheel and the second Idle wheel, the first Idle wheel and the second Idle wheel are arranged on Idle wheel fixed support, Idle wheel fixed support is fixed on the fitting seat of the second follower, and the first Idle wheel, the second Idle wheel, Idle wheel fixed support move up and down and realize dynamic tension with fitting seat.
The advantage that the utility model is given prominence to is compared to existing technology:
1, the utility model, by the combination of eccentric center tensioner device and dynamic tension device, can make the automatic cutting bed proper motion that keeps output power certain (driving belt is not loosening, jumps tooth) and mechanism in the time promoting and decline whole knife system;
2, the utility model eccentric center tensioner device be applicable to space requirement little and be not suitable for the place with some common tensioning mechanisms such as screws, and install easy to adjust, in the process that this device is applicable to driving belt to move at itself, also to frequently move up and down, its stable drive, stable output.
